Can dogs drink Minute Maid juice safely?

Yesterday, some guests were over for a barbecue and someone accidentally spilled a bit of Minute Maid juice on the patio, which my dog eagerly licked up before I could stop him. I've heard mixed things about dogs consuming sugar and artificial ingredients. Is it alright for dogs to drink a little Minute Maid juice, or could this pose any health risks to him?

Answer

If your dog consumed a small amount of Minute Maid juice, it's generally not a cause for immediate concern, but keeping an eye on them for any unusual symptoms is wise.

  • Watch for symptoms such as vomiting, diarrhea, or excessive thirst.
  • Check the ingredients for harmful substances like xylitol, which is toxic to dogs.
  • Offer fresh water and monitor eating and drinking habits.
  • If you notice any worrying symptoms, consult a veterinarian.

While a small amount of juice might not be harmful, it's important to know that dogs don't need sugary drinks or those with artificial ingredients in their diet. Such items can upset their stomachs or lead to more serious health issues over time, like obesity or dental problems. Always try to prevent access to human food and drinks that are not safe for them.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• Can Minute Maid juice be toxic to dogs?

    Most Minute Maid juices contain sugar and artificial ingredients that are not ideal for dogs but aren't immediately toxic unless they contain xylitol, which is poisonous.

  • What should I do if my dog shows signs of illness after drinking juice?

    If your dog shows signs such as vomiting, diarrhea, or unusual behavior after consuming juice, contact a veterinarian promptly for advice.

  • How can I prevent my dog from consuming harmful foods?

    Keep all human foods out of reach, educate guests about not feeding pets, and provide safe, dog-friendly treats as alternatives.
